Lot Description
An Edwardian 18ct gold opal three-stone ring, with old-cut diamond spacers.
Hallmarks for Birmingham, 1901. Ring size R. 3.6gms.

Condition Report
<li>Scratches and small marks.
<li>Hallmarks worn, maker's mark indistinct.
<li>Estimated total diamond weight 0.15ct.
<li>Opals appear well matched with fair to good play of colour across a range of hues. Moderate abrasions. One of the smaller opals with a small chip.
